I've tried both MiraWizARC and PackMast (both included with the wonderful ClassicWB) to extract these LZX files but neither work, nothing happens etc

WizARC handles LZX files just fine, I tried it a minute ago. Keep in mind that it is just a frontend, and not the extractor itself, though. To work with LZX files, you need the LZX executable in your c: and the keyfile in the correct place.
